What kind of damages can my daughter recover after she was hit and run over by a car in a crosswalk ?

Asked by a user in Fort Worth, TX - 8 months ago.

The Texas Transportation Code provides in part that the operator of a motor vehicle shall yield the right of way to a pedestrian in a cross walk. Typical damages in claims like yours include past and future medical expenses, past and future physical pain and suffering, past and future physical impairment, past and future mental anguish and damages for disfigurement.
